In Chapter 7 of "The Lekki Headmaster," what significant event involving ritualists impacts the community and the main characters?

  • A public ceremony that celebrates their traditions
  • The disappearance of a local child linked to ritualistic practices
  • The opening of a new school funded by the ritualists
  • A confrontation between the headmaster and the ritualists

Correct Answer: B

Explanation
Correct Option: B. The disappearance of a local child linked to ritualistic practices Detailed Explanation: In Chapter 7 of "The Lekki Headmaster," the narrative takes a dark turn with the significant event of a local child's disappearance, which is linked to ritualistic practices. This event is pivotal for several reasons:
  1. Impact on the Community: The disappearance of a child creates a ripple effect throughout the community. It instills fear and anxiety among the residents, as they grapple with the implications of such a heinous act. The community's sense of safety is shattered, leading to distrust and suspicion among neighbors. This event serves as a catalyst for the characters to confront the darker aspects of their society, including the existence of ritualists who exploit fear and superstition.
  2. Character Development: The main characters, particularly the headmaster, are deeply affected by this incident. It challenges their values and beliefs, pushing them to take a stand against the ritualists. The headmaster, who is often portrayed as a figure of authority and morality, must navigate the complexities of community dynamics and the fear that ritualistic practices instill. This event propels character development, as they are forced to confront their own fears and the moral implications of inaction.
  3. Themes of Fear and Superstition: The disappearance highlights the themes of fear and superstition that run throughout the narrative. It illustrates how easily a community can be swayed by rumors and the unknown, leading to irrational behavior. The fear of ritualists becomes a powerful tool that can manipulate the community, showcasing the dangers of superstition and the need for rationality and education.
  4. Plot Progression: This event is crucial for the plot as it sets the stage for subsequent actions taken by the characters. The headmaster and other community leaders may feel compelled to take action, whether through community meetings, investigations, or confrontations with the ritualists. This tension drives the narrative forward, creating a sense of urgency and engagement for the reader.
